Eyrewell Forest vs Rio Gallegos Climate & Distance Between

Argentina flag
  • The distance between Eyrewell Forest, New Zealand and Rio Gallegos, Argentina is approximately 7,908 km or 4,914 mi.
  • To reach Eyrewell Forest in this distance one would set out from Rio Gallegos bearing 222.5° or SW and follow the great circles arc to approach Eyrewell Forest bearing 324.8° or NW .
  • Eyrewell Forest has a marine west coast climate (Cfb) whereas Rio Gallegos has a mid-latitude cool steppe climate (BSk).
  • Eyrewell Forest is in or near the cool temperate steppe biome whereas Rio Gallegos is in or near the cool temperate desert scrub biome.
  • The annual average temperature is 3.4 °C (6.1°F) warmer.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 1 °C (1.8°F) less in Eyrewell Forest. The continentality subtype is truly oceanic for both.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 506.5 mm (19.9 in) more which is equivalent to 506.5 l/m² (12.43 US gal/ft²) or 5,065,000 l/ha (541,482 US gal/ac) more. About 3 as much.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 8.2° higher in Eyrewell Forest than in Rio Gallegos.
